2011-10-22 40 views
-2

FTPでファイルインジェクションプログラムを作成しています {ユーザーがプログラムを実行すると、別のプログラムを遠隔のフォルダにダウンロードしてそのプログラムを実行します} 私のシステムのzipファイル32倍のpythonは私に叫び、あなたはそれを行うことができます!IOError:[Errno 13]アクセス許可が拒否されました。

私はこれを回避するために使用できるモジュールはありますか? おかげでここに私のコードのオペレーティング・システム・レベルの保護をだ

l_zipfile = open("C:\\Program Files\\"+zipfilename, 'w'

+0

py2exeでコンパイルしてから、管理者として実行してください。 –

答えて

1

です。問題を回避するためのモジュールがあれば、Windowsは私が思う以上に多くを吸う。これはたくさんある。

は別のディレクトリに書き込みます。

+2

窓についてのご意見をお待ちください。 –

+2

@ P'sao - 私は自分の意見をWindowsに残しておいてください。しかし、私は自分自身に満足するでしょう、私はそこにWindowsのセキュリティを壊すモジュールはないと確信することはできません.2つは、DOSとその子孫の両方で20年以上働いています。 )とUnix(そしてそれは子孫です)と一緒に。どのような経験や情報があなたのコメントに基づいていましたか? – Malvolio

+0

私はあなたの経験にあなたの意見だと言ったように。一方、私は自分の経験で私の意見を持っています。 –

0

は、[管理者として実行py2exeでそれをコンパイルします。これは私のために働いた。

0

このリンクでフォーラムから、次の手順に従ってください - 私は仮想CloneDriveをインストールしたとき、私はそれを.ISOファイルを関連付けて

http://ubuntuforums.org/showthread.php?p=10416349

「私は、Virtual CloneDriveを(そのフリーウェア、それをグーグル)ダウンロード他の人はいませんでした。私は最初にダウンロードした.isoファイルをダブルクリックして、直接私のProgram Filesフォルダから直接作成しました。それは仮想ドライブとしてマウントして起動し、アクセス拒否のエラーはディスクドライブと関係があると思うが、修正できなかった」

関連する問題